held a working meeting to strengthen coordinated economic promotion efforts and showcase the business opportunities Peru offers abroad.
During the session, the newly appointed economic and trade counselors assigned to priority markets such as London, New Delhi, Tokyo, Paris, and Milan were introduced.
The Cabinet member highlighted the experience gained through joint work between Peru's embassies and consulates and PromPeru's trade offices, underscoring their contribution to positioning the country in international markets.
During the event, the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and PromPeru reaffirmed their commitment to strengthening external action in the areas of trade, investment, tourism, and gastronomy.
It was also agreed on the importance of diversifying markets and promoting higher value-added export offerings as key elements in driving Peru's economic development.
